Operations Administrator Role and Responsibilities:
* Answering telephones as first point of contact, dealing with queries or re-directing as appropriate.
* Processing of Guarantee applications in all formats (manual, download and via online Guarantee Generator) and printing of associated invoices.
* Liaison with Installer and System Designer Members regarding Guarantee applications and reports.
* Dealing with customer and third-party copy Guarantee requests.
* Sending of remedial reports to contractors for tender in line with the requirements of the Procurement Framework.
* General administration support.
* Handling inbound and outbound post.
* Operate in a manner that is consistent with good Health and Safety practice and does not present hazards to others.
* Any other duties reasonably expected by your Line Manager.
